Sans Faceted Omda 2 is a regular weight, normal width, monoline, upright, normal x-height font.

This typeface is built from straight strokes and crisp joins, replacing most curves with short planar segments that create a faceted outline. Stroke weight stays even throughout, with generous apertures and clear internal counters that keep letters open at text sizes. Proportions are straightforward and broadly geometric, with consistent cap height and a moderate x-height; round characters like O/C/G read as polygonal rather than circular. Terminals are predominantly flat or sharply cut, giving the overall texture a clean, slightly engineered rhythm across lines of text.

It suits interface labels, dashboards, and product contexts where clean shapes and fast recognition matter, especially at medium sizes. The faceted geometry also performs well for headlines, posters, and contemporary branding where a subtle technical signature can differentiate otherwise neutral sans typography. For signage and wayfinding, the open counters and straightforward forms help maintain readability.

The faceted construction and even stroke color project a contemporary, technical tone with a subtle sci‑fi edge. It feels rational and purposeful rather than expressive, leaning toward clarity and structure while still adding a distinctive angular character. The result is crisp and modern, suitable for designs that want precision without becoming sterile.

The design appears intended to blend the practicality of a simple sans with a distinctive faceted geometry, offering a recognizable voice without relying on ornament. By keeping strokes uniform and structures open, it aims for functional legibility while introducing a controlled, angular aesthetic that signals modernity and precision.

In running text the font maintains a steady grayscale and legible word shapes, while the angular treatment becomes most noticeable in round letters and curved joins. Numerals follow the same cut, geometric logic, keeping a cohesive voice across alphanumerics.
